What Are the Legal Requirements of a Financial POA in Oklahoma? Mental Capacity for Creating a POA. ... Notarization Requirement. ... Create the POA Using a Statutory Form, Software, or Attorney. ... Sign the POA in the Presence of a Notary Public. ... Store the Original POA in a Safe Place. ... Give a Copy to Your Agent or Attorney-in-Fact.
